Understanding This Legal Service

Joint ventures and strategic alliances are collaborative arrangements designed to pursue a shared objective while preserving each party’s separate interests. They vary from simple contracts for co-marketing to sophisticated equity-funded structures. Understanding the differences helps partners choose the right framework and allocate risk, control, and profits accordingly.
Key legal considerations include governance rights, capital contributions, IP ownership, confidentiality, antitrust compliance, and exit strategies. Thoughtful negotiation and precise drafting reduce friction and enable smoother collaboration, allowing Roseboro companies to move quickly while minimizing exposure to dispute resolution costs.

Definition and Explanation

A joint venture is a distinct business arrangement created by two or more entities to pursue a defined project or market opportunity. A strategic alliance is a broader collaboration that may rely on shared resources without forming a new entity, enabling participants to leverage complementary strengths over time.

Key Elements and Processes

Key elements include purpose, governance framework, funding commitments, milestone-based outputs, risk allocation, and dispute resolution provisions. The processes typically involve due diligence, negotiation, drafting of the agreement, regulatory review, and ongoing performance assessments to ensure alignment with strategic objectives.

Key Terms and Glossary

Common terms include ownership structure, control rights, exit triggers, non-compete provisions, IP licenses, and confidentiality agreements. A clear glossary helps ensure all parties share the same definitions throughout negotiations and implementation.

What is the difference between a joint venture and a strategic alliance?

A joint venture creates a new, independent entity or a defined project with shared ownership and profits, while a strategic alliance is a broader collaboration that may not form a separate business. The JV typically involves equity and governance, whereas alliances rely on contractual rights and shared resources. The choice depends on goals, control preferences, and risk tolerance.

Formal joint ventures are often appropriate for long-term expansion, large-scale projects, or significant resource pooling. They provide structured governance and clearer accountability. For limited, rapidly evolving opportunities, a strategic alliance or licensing may offer faster deployment with less overhead and risk.
